A beam of precast concrete units which are … WebIn a Nut Shell: The topic of shear flow frequently occurs when dealing with “built-up” beams. These are beams fabricated with several pieces joined by glue, nails, bolts, or welds. These fasteners must be sufficiently strong to withstand the lateral (transverse) or longitudinal shear. WebSection modulus is a geometric property for a given cross-section used in the design of beams or flexural members. Other geometric properties used in design include area for tension and shear, radius of gyration for compression, and second moment of area and polar second moment of area for stiffness. long term use of oxygen
